As a Fire Safety Inspector, you will be responsible for inspecting buildings and facilities to ensure compliance with fire safety codes, regulations, and standards.

Your role will be crucial in safeguarding public safety and preventing fire hazards through effective inspections and enforcement.

Key Responsibilities :

  • Conduct inspections of commercial, residential, and industrial buildings to assess compliance with fire safety codes, regulations, and standards.
  • Review and evaluate fire safety plans, fire alarm systems, sprinkler systems, and other fire protection measures to ensure they meet regulatory requirements.
  • Identify and document fire hazards, code violations, and safety deficiencies, and recommend corrective actions to address issues.
  • Prepare detailed inspection reports and maintain accurate records of inspections, violations, and enforcement actions.
  • Provide guidance and support to property owners, managers, and business operators regarding fire safety practices and regulatory compliance.
  • Respond to fire safety-related inquiries and complaints, and investigate incidents or violations as needed.
  • Collaborate with fire departments, emergency responders, and other municipal agencies to address fire safety concerns and support public safety initiatives.
  • Stay updated on changes in fire safety codes, regulations, and industry best practices to ensure effective inspections and recommendations.
